You Can't Become My Special SomeoneA back alley just off the main entertainment district. A hidden bar you'd never find without an introduction. The bartender who works there—Shiki Enomoto, 27 years old. Standing at 188 cm, with multiple piercings and tattoos of snakes and roses. A man who's easy to get along with, quick to close the distance, and always seems to be enjoying himself. He never lacks for women. He doesn't turn away affection, and if he likes someone too, he'll simply say "I like you." He never fixates on any one person, and he never chases after those who leave. He welcomes those who come, and never pursues those who go. And with this Shiki, you've been friends for a long time. You didn't meet as a customer at his bar. You know his relaxed daytime self, and the way he lets his guard down at home. You visit each other's places. You exchange silly messages. When one of you is in trouble, you help each other as if it's only natural. And so, you can't help but hope a little. Maybe you're different from other women. You're not a customer. You're not a fling. If you're someone who simply exists in his everyday life— —maybe someday, you could become Shiki's "special someone." And Shiki does like you, too. If you ask, "Do you like me?" "I like you." He'd surely answer without a moment's hesitation. But— If you say, "Then go out with me"— "Why?" What comes back is a genuine question, with no malice or joking behind it. To Shiki, "liking someone" and "choosing one person" are two different things. He's never wanted to monopolize anyone. He's never chased after someone who was leaving. But what if, for the first time, a man like that— found himself thinking, "I don't want you to go." He welcomes those who come, and never pursues those who go. Can you become the "special someone" who makes him abandon that way of living?

The General Manager Is Sweet Only to YouA prestigious luxury hotel standing in one of Tokyo's finest locations—HOTEL VALENCOURT. At its pinnacle stands the general manager, Seiji Mido (35). Standing 190 cm tall, with silver hair and sharp eyes. Calm and composed, he allows no compromise when it comes to work, and rarely shows his emotions. At first glance, he seems cold and unapproachable. But in reality, he observes those around him more closely than anyone, and once he notices a subordinate's physical condition or a guest's small preferences, he never forgets them. It is at HOTEL VALENCOURT that you meet this man. You are free to choose your role. ◆ Working as hotel staff As Seiji's subordinate, you see him almost every day. Though he is fair and strict with everyone, for some reason he alone notices even the slightest change in you. "You can head home for today." "...You look pale. Don't push yourself." Small acts of special treatment that even he himself doesn't realize. When will they turn into "special feelings"? ◆ Staying as a hotel guest A guest and the general manager. Ordinarily, a relationship that should never go beyond that. And yet, after several visits, he remembers your name, remembers your preferences, and before long begins to take notice of the days you come to the hotel. "It's been a while. ...I'm glad to see you again." A man who never mixes work with personal feelings, for the first time in his life, finds himself wanting to cross the line he himself drew. Will you become his subordinate? Or—will you become a special guest?

The Divine Visage Knows Not YetWhat the kingdom's investigator found deep within the sealed sanctuary was— a woman who, until the age of twenty-one, had never known the world outside. Her name was Iris. Raised in a cloistered religious order, she was called the "Divine Visage"—a being cultivated as a pure vessel to reflect the divine will upon the earth. To hold no selfish desires. To hate no one, to refuse no one. To bestow equal compassion upon all. That was the way of being demanded of the Divine Visage. What to eat. What to wear. Where to go. She never needed to choose even such trivial things for herself. And— she was not even permitted to hold anyone "special" in her heart. When the order's financial misconduct came to light, her existence was discovered by chance, and at twenty-one, Iris was taken into protection and brought into the outside world for the first time. Due to certain circumstances, she begins to live quietly with you. "What would you like for dinner?" Even when asked, "Anything is fine. Whatever you wish." she would only smile. She still barely understands that she even has the right to choose. Sharing meals together. Walking through the town. Choosing what she wants. Saying no to what she dislikes. Through such ordinary days, Iris gradually comes to know her "self." And one day, perhaps— if someone should appear in her heart, a heart that was meant to bestow equal compassion upon all, just one person— someone she wishes would stay by her side. She does not yet know that this is called "love." This is the story of a girl who was once the Divine Visage, becoming simply "Iris."
